Copying Book: Secretary's Letters, 1860 (page 455)

Dear Sir,

I sent you bill for $64.75 for grading your lot in Mount Auburn some months since. You complained of dissatisfaction, and made an appointment with the ^to meet the Superintendent here on a certain day & hour, but you failed to meet the appointment -- You have not been here to arrange it since, that I can learn --

I must once more request your immediate attention to the bill.

Respectfully yours

A.J. Coolidge Treasr

Robert Simpson Esq

Lewis Jones Esq

Dear Sir,

I have carefully gone over again the accounts against you and believe them to be correct.

I struck from the charges against you one of $3.00 for unloading stone on lot 510 -- sold by you to H.L. Richardson.

I trust you will settle these forthwith.

Amt against you personally $54.00
" " you for a/c H.H. Jones 55.95
[total] $109.95
Yours truly

A.J. Coolidge

Treasr
